Pueblo Hotlap Video

If you've never seen the track, download the following and start studying the line. This fast track is the longest road course in Colorado and is lots of fun!

http://www.whapp.com/sm/pueblo_944_april2003.mpg

Video is courtesy of Rick Snyder who will be heading up Group2 HPDE for us. He's got some other good videos on his site: http://www.snymo.com/

Thanks for the link . . . what is Rick driving in that video? Something European? What kind of vehicle/tires/level of prep?
It's an SCCA Club Racing ITS Porsche 944. Basically it's a pretty stock motor, stripped car, and lots of suspension work. Tires are Kumho Ecsta V700s.

Any idea what kind of top speed you hit at the end of the front straight? And how is the track surface these days?

Your video was shot in 2003 apparently right?
I believe the top speed was around 120ish in that car. Straight line power was never it's best quality, but it could handle and break with the best of them. That video was from 2003. There have been improvements to the track since then, but I haven't been there since 2004 so I don't know what the current condition is. However, they are in the process of major adjustments to meet the SCCA Club Racing sactioning guidelines, so expect it to be as good as it's ever been when we get there!
